Satellite feeds show that a wind has speed of 10 km/h going to the south. It will meet Habagat (southwest monsoon) whose speed is 7.72 m/s which is moving 30° southwest. Suppose that no other force affects these winds, and they meet, is there a need for PAGASA to issue a public storm warning signal (PSWS)? Yes or No? Why? Note: Conversion of units is needed to solve the problem. Show all necessary solutions with diagrams and label all vectors properly. Resultant vector's magnitude and direction. Typhoon signal number 1 has 30 to 60 km/h wind speed.
